Genesis Minerals:

Our price target is based on DCF with a 6% WACC and a US$3,250/oz long-term gold price.

Investment risk inherent in the resource sector includes, but is not limited to movement of

commodity price and currency which may differ materially from the assumptions used in this

report. Furthermore, the sector is subject to political, financial and operational risks, each of

which has the potential to significantly impact industry performance. Mid/small cap gold

miners have added volatility in reserve extension risks. GMD have the added risk of project

growth and delivery, in particular due to the age of their assets (Gwalia). Risks beyond the

base case to our forecasts include delays to production ramp up, delivery and potential cost

escalation in late stage delivery.
